Type
ORACLE
Validation date
2025-07-01 10:16: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 1.6548e-4,
    "usd": 1.9562e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013CFF3AC8C780AF1D2C4D494A18E705B1766DF14EDB9CBB4681E2E1EA86764128

Previous signature

3E8E35C9A363CFCD712593AF5A39F28D0076D8FAA5D144327E96A1AFEEC9136D6F01EE62A0D78C274030FD51E52D7FF7F01C549335A76311807CEF9D62BC9700

Origin signature

3045022100D2D80E7A4E3364D1313BE34739A0BB1F04F0ABA82D6EE9BFA920DAA7B76082600220053720003D860CED7020AA5809D038D59BFB14A50EB6F8BFD7BEC3A80C508C8B

Proof of work

0102046050ACF5683F8B40CF2A1C5CE45B7C3CAF7105CE3C4B5425C390F31B15BE4F57A184F3BE1D755D2290068463C3E123BFA6338B3B06A20D94329B1DC785B511C6

Proof of integrity

0005E097DF6098E3A02BECB53A86F35522D57642EEFCA265A597E1332EAFEFD0E5

Coordinator signature

CF11F3E32CEEAFE3DCD1A111D1DBB1E514A88964CE15818D70AB44A6AF71EE8AF4DDB3F2052E0B12D9D8EAD09625B9D8952F4FA318B8DF5AB6A8CFCA34AF5102

Validator #1 public key

0001671D93D364D58629CA072EDF6D1831E85B4283C066CD82525C33DED58CC74BF6

Validator #1 signature

5604469C32025272DFCC4F1F12126F513D10D199A054FDA3C93BC41AFF117834C1DA640E6679E25651D613CA7D9C1C6F53E3DA6A09F36EFDAADF86E99E0F1D08

Validator #2 public key

00019AD94822B40BF5D4B6874848D7BAB37D351DAB7CFEE31B5A44D58A5961DAB123

Validator #2 signature

144593D6F9F5D7A87E81422F094548AC9C67C455177A81A4B206C00BEC1547430026C45937E1076C443CC82A68B486E48E5901AA1622281D0004340558821B0A